In settings, sounds, system sounds, there is an option for system clicks
I have that turned off, but everything's I tap the keyboard it clicks. How do I turn off the clicking sound?
Apple says sounds &haptics but I can't find that option
Edit: solved : I have a third party keyboard SwiftKey installed. That was what was doing it. Forgot I had that installed. Dealing with this for a year. Lol

So I use this really cool feature a lot on my iPhone, and I really love how you can make text replacements. I have a lot so I could easily shortcut my way through conversations.
For example:
Whenever I type “tm” it results in “/me”, this is because I am actively on twitch and kick. This is the same with Channel Points.
What’s your thoughts on the iOS text replacements feature, do you use it or have you heard of it? I don’t see much people talking about this feature or maybe I’m not in the right zone of iOS.
To enable it if you have not yet knew about this feature;
Setting > General > Keyboard > Text Replacement
